Role Summary:
We are looking for a new Data Analyst/Report Writer to complement our IT Department. The Galway Clinic has the most advanced Electronic Medical Record in Ireland, with a very data-rich environment. The organization is comprised of over 50 different departments with various systems and business needs, creating a vast and complex infrastructure in terms of processes and data.
The role is focused on developing reports for the business and providing the organization with critical data needed to support both clinical and financial operations.
This role requires excellent communication skills to deal directly with departments and gather their business needs to transform them into technical requirements. The candidate will need to become familiar with the organizational workflows to understand data sources and locations.
